What Is a Crypto Game Casino?
A crypto game casino is an online gambling plat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and stablecoins like GBPC-- as the primary form of payment. Unlike traditional online gambling establishments that count on fiat currencies and central payment processors, crypto gambling establishments utilize blockchain networks to facilitate deposits, withdrawals, and in‑game deals. Much of these platforms also integrate smart agreements to impose video game guidelines automatically, providing a level of fairness that gamers can verify independently.
Typical elements include:
- Wallet combination: Players connect a suitable crypto wallet (e.g., MetaMask, Trust Wallet) to the site.
- Provably fair algorithms: Each bet's result can be investigated through cryptographic hashes, ensuring the casino can not manipulate results.
- Immediate settlements: Because blockchain transactions clear within minutes (or seconds for certain layer‑2 services), wins are credited nearly right away.
How Do Crypto Game Casinos Work?
- Account Creation
Users join an e-mail or a pseudonym, and numerous platforms permit anonymous play. No Know‑Your‑Customer (KYC) documentation is required in the majority of jurisdictions, though some licensed operators may request verification for withdrawal limitations. - Funding the Wallet
After linking a crypto wallet, players move funds from an exchange or personal journal into the casino's designated address. The platform normally supports numerous chains; some even auto‑convert less‑popular altcoins to a base currency (e.g., BTC or ETH) to improve gameplay. - Positioning Bets
Games exist in a web‑based lobby. Bets are positioned in the platform's internal currency (often a stablecoin pegged to GBP). The gamer's balance updates quickly on the blockchain, and each spin or hand is taped as a transaction. - Withdrawing Winnings
When a gamer demands a payout, the casino initiates a blockchain transfer to the player's external wallet. Withdrawal times differ from a few minutes to a number of hours, depending on network blockage and the casino's internal processing policy.

Security and Regulation
While crypto gambling establishments provide privacy, they are not exempt from legal oversight. The majority of credible operators acquire licenses that need:
- Random Number Generation Certification: Independent screening laboratories validate the fairness of the RNG.
- Anti‑Money‑Laundering (AML) Policies: Even without complete KYC, lots of platforms keep an eye on for suspicious deal patterns.
- Freezer: The bulk of gamer funds are held in offline wallets to reduce hacking dangers.
Players ought to also practice personal security: enable 2FA, usage hardware wallets for big holdings, and avoid sharing personal secrets.
